Distributed Sensing on a 110-kV Overhead-Line Maintenance Operation on an Operational Optical Ground Wire

Konstantinos Alexoudis, Torm Järvelill, Hendrik Johann Kerm, Kaida Kaeval, Florian Azendorf, Vincent Sleiffer, Jasper Müller, Chigo Okonkwo, Tom Bradley

eess.SParXiv:2609.18767

Abstract

We demonstrate dual-modal distributed sensing on an operational 110-kV OPGW during crane maintenance. DAS resolves meter-scale lifting events and matches impulsive events to phone audio, while DTSS quantifies post-reclamping residual strain up to 398 με, enabling maintenance verification and asset monitoring in transmission grids.
